# Use a Fine-Tuned Model

You can use models you have trained or uploaded to Roboflow with the video inference API.

### Use a Fine-Tuned Model with the Video Inference API

First, install the Roboflow Python package:

```bash
pip install roboflow
```

Next, create a new Python file and add the following code:

```python
from roboflow import Roboflow

rf = Roboflow(api_key="API_KEY")
project = rf.workspace().project("PROJECT_NAME")
model = project.version(MODEL_ID).models()[0]

job_id, signed_url, expire_time = model.predict_video(
    "football-video.mp4",
    fps=5,
    prediction_type="batch-video",
)

results = model.poll_until_video_results(job_id)

print(results)
```

Above, replace:

* `API_KEY`: with your Roboflow API key
* `PROJECT_NAME`: with your Roboflow project ID.
* `MODEL_ID`: with your Roboflow model ID.

*Important note: Currently Roboflow's video inference only supports models trained within Roboflow after June 30th, 2023. We are working toward including older models.*
